Edmonton judge to allow broadcast of Travis Vader murder verdict in one-time ruling


Travis Vader is on trial for the murders of Lyle and Marie McCann, who vanished on a camping trip in 2010. ( AMBER BRACKEN / THE CANADIAN PRESS )EDMONTON—A judge is allowing a news camera to broadcast his verdict in the murder trial of a man accused of killing two Alberta seniors. The CBC, the Edmonton Journal, Global News, CTV and The Canadian Press had asked the judge to allow the camera in court. Travis Vader has pleaded not guilty to two counts of first-degree murder in the 2010 deaths of Lyle and Marie McCann, who vanished on a camping trip. The defence and the McCann family said they supported a public broadcast of the decision.
